S44660 Stainless Steel vs. S35115 Stainless Steel

Both S44660 stainless steel and S35115 stainless steel are iron alloys. Both are furnished in the annealed condition. They have 81%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S44660 stainless steel and the bottom bar is S35115 stainless steel.
